Java Programming for Beginners to Advanced – Learn Step-by-Step
About This Course
This course is designed for anyone who wants to learn Java programming from scratch and become job-ready. You will start with basics and gradually move to Object-Oriented Programming, file handling, data structures, and project-level applications.
Through lessons, assignments, and quizzes, you will gain strong hands-on experience to build real-world Java applications confidently.
By the end of this course, you’ll be able to create Java programs, understand OOP architecture, and apply your knowledge to automation, app development, or interviews.
Learning Objectives
Understand the basics of Java syntax and programming flow
Work with variables, data types, and operators
Apply conditionals, loops, and logical statements
Understand and implement Object-Oriented Programming concepts
Build real-world projects using Java
Understand file handling, arrays, and exception handling
Prepare for interviews using Java fundamentals
Material Includes
- Downloadable lecture notes (PDF format)
- Python code files and source scripts
- Quizzes and assignments for every chapter
- Mini-project with full explanation and downloadable code
- (Optional) Completion certificate (depends on your LMS settings)
Requirements
- Laptop or PC
- Internet connection
- No programming experience needed
Target Audience
- Students
- Beginners in coding
- Developers switching from Python/C++
- Anyone preparing for IT jobs
Curriculum
3 Lessons